Exploring the Reasoning Behind Lower Hair Transplant Costs in Turkey

Introduction:

Hair loss is a common concern for many individuals, and hair transplantation has emerged as a popular solution for restoring hair and confidence. In recent years, Turkey has gained significant recognition as a global hub for hair transplant procedures, attracting numerous international patients. One of the chief factors driving this trend is Turkey's relatively lower cost of hair transplants compared to other countries. In this article, we will delve into the reasons behind the lower hair transplant costs in Turkey, shedding light on the quality, expertise, and cost-effective factors contributing to hair transplant procedures' affordability.

Lower Labor and Operational Costs:

One of the primary reasons for Turkey's lower hair transplant costs is the difference in labor and operational costs compared to Western countries. Turkey has a lower price of living and labor rates, which directly affects the overall cost of the procedure. The expenses of running a hair transplant clinic, such as rent, utilities, and staffing, are comparatively lower in Turkey. This allows clinics to offer more affordable prices without compromising the quality of the treatment.

High Competition:

Turkey has a highly competitive hair transplant market, with numerous clinics and specialists offering their services. This intense competition creates an environment where clinics strive to attract more patients by providing competitive prices. To stand out and attract international clients, clinics in Turkey often provide hair transplant packages that include accommodation, transportation, and other amenities, making the overall cost even more appealing.

Medical Tourism Incentives:

Turkey actively promotes medical tourism and has implemented policies to facilitate and encourage international patients seeking hair transplant procedures. The government has invested in infrastructure, healthcare facilities, and technologies, creating a supportive environment for medical tourism. This dedication to the medical tourism industry allows clinics in Turkey to offer cost-effective packages and services to attract more international patients.

Economies of Scale:

Due to the high demand for hair transplant procedures in Turkey, many clinics perform surgeries daily. This high volume of cases allows clinics to benefit from economies of scale. They can negotiate better deals with suppliers for equipment, consumables, and medications, reducing the overall cost per procedure. These savings are often passed on to patients, lowering hair transplant costs.

Skilled and Experienced Surgeons:

Turkey is renowned for its skilled and experienced hair transplant surgeons. Many Turkish surgeons have undergone extensive training and have honed their skills through years of practice. The expertise and proficiency of these surgeons contribute to the success and quality of hair transplant procedures in Turkey. Despite their high level of knowledge, the lower labor costs in the country allow clinics to offer more affordable prices for their services.

Availability of Advanced Technology:

Turkey has invested in advanced medical technology, including state-of-the-art equipment and facilities for hair transplant procedures. While the cost of acquiring and maintaining these technologies can be substantial, the lower operational costs in Turkey make it feasible for clinics to offer more affordable treatment options. Affected role can benefit from the latest techniques and technologies without incurring exorbitant expenses.

Favorable Exchange Rates:

Favorable exchange rates can contribute to the cost advantage for international patients seeking hair transplant procedures in Turkey. Currencies such as the Euro, Pound Sterling, or US Dollar often have higher conversion rates than the Turkish Lira. This means that international patients can use the currency exchange rate and obtain high-quality hair transplants at a lower cost.

Conclusion:

The lower cost of hair transplantations in Turkey can be credited to a mixture of factors, including lower labor and operational costs, high competition, government incentives for medical tourism, economies of scale, skilled surgeons, advanced technology, and favorable exchange rates. These factors allow clinics in Turkey to provide cost-effective hair transplant procedures without compromising on quality or expertise.
